1. What is Periareolar Lift Augmentation?

Periareolar lift augmentation, also known as mastopexy, is a surgical procedure that combines breast lift techniques with augmentation to improve the size, shape, and position of the breasts. It is commonly sought by women who are unhappy with sagging breasts or have lost volume due to pregnancy, weight loss, or aging.

The procedure involves making an incision around the areola (the dark-colored skin surrounding the nipple) and removing excess skin to lift the breasts. In some cases, breast implants may also be inserted to achieve the desired fullness and shape. The surgeon will tailor the technique to meet individual patient needs.

Periareolar lift augmentation typically takes a few hours to complete under general anesthesia.

3. Risks and Considerations

Like any surgical procedure, periareolar lift augmentation carries some risks and considerations. It is crucial to thoroughly discuss these with your surgeon before making a decision. Some potential risks include:

Scarring: While efforts are made to minimize scarring, it is essential to understand that some degree of scarring is inevitable. The extent and visibility of scars will vary depending on individual healing processes.

Changes in nipple sensation: Periareolar lift augmentation may temporarily or permanently affect nipple sensation. Some patients experience increased sensitivity, while others may have decreased sensation.

Breastfeeding: The ability to breastfeed may be compromised after periareolar lift augmentation. It is important to discuss your plans for future pregnancies with your surgeon.

Implant-related risks: If breast implants are included in the procedure, there are additional risks to consider, such as implant rupture, capsular contracture, and the need for future implant-related surgeries.

4. Recovery Process

Understanding the recovery process is crucial for a smooth and successful periareolar lift augmentation. Here are some general guidelines to expect:

Post-operative care: Your surgeon will provide detailed instructions on caring for your incisions, wearing supportive garments, and managing any discomfort, swelling, or bruising.

Physical restrictions: You will need to avoid strenuous activities and heavy lifting for several weeks after surgery. It is important to follow your surgeon's advice to ensure proper healing.

Swelling and bruising: Some swelling and bruising are normal after periareolar lift augmentation, but it should subside gradually over several weeks. You may be advised to use cold compresses and elevate your upper body to minimize swelling.

Healing time: While it varies by individual, most patients can expect to resume normal daily activities within a few weeks. However, it may take several months for the final results to become apparent as the breasts settle into their new position.

6. Costs of Periareolar Lift Augmentation

The cost of periareolar lift augmentation varies depending on factors such as the surgeon's experience, location, surgical technique, anesthesia fees, and the inclusion of breast implants. On average, the procedure cost ranges from $5,000 to $10,000. It is important to obtain a detailed cost breakdown from your surgeon during the consultation.

8.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How long do the results of periareolar lift augmentation last?

A: The results of periareolar lift augmentation are long-lasting, but it is important to remember that the natural aging process and lifestyle factors may affect the appearance of your breasts over time. Maintaining a healthy lifestyle and regular check-ups with your surgeon can help preserve the results.

Q: Will I have visible scars after periareolar lift augmentation?

A: While some scarring is inevitable, skilled surgeons aim to minimize the visibility of scars. The incisions are strategically placed to be concealed within the natural contours of the breasts and may fade over time.

Q: Can I combine periareolar lift augmentation with other procedures?

A: Yes, periareolar lift augmentation can be combined with other procedures such as breast reduction or tummy tuck, depending on your goals and overall health. It is important to consult with your surgeon to determine the most suitable combination and discuss any potential risks.

Q: When can I return to work after periareolar lift augmentation?

A: The recovery time varies for each individual, but many patients are able to return to work within one to two weeks after surgery. This timeline can be discussed with your surgeon based on your specific job requirements and healing progress.

Q: Are there non-surgical alternatives to periareolar lift augmentation?

A: While non-surgical treatments like radiofrequency therapy or dermal fillers can provide temporary improvements in breast appearance, they cannot achieve the same degree of lift and long-term results as periareolar lift augmentation. It is best to consult with a qualified surgeon to determine the most suitable option for your goals.
